Finances
£10,561,000 latest income
| Year | Income | Spending |
|---|---|---|
| 2020 | £7,750,000 | £7,284,000 |
| 2021 | £7,178,000 | £7,058,000 |
| 2022 | £7,733,000 | £8,000,000 |
| 2023 | £9,869,000 | £9,180,000 |
| 2024 | £10,561,000 | £10,641,000 |
What it does
What
Education/trainingArts/culture/heritage/scienceEnvironment/conservation/heritageWho
Other Defined GroupsThe General Public/mankindHow
Provides Advocacy/advice/informationSponsors Or Undertakes ResearchActs As An Umbrella Or Resource BodyCharitable objects
THE OBJECTS OF THE INSTITUTE (HEREINAFTER REFERRED TO AS THE "OBJECTS") SHALL BE THE PROMOTION FOR THE PUBLIC BENEFIT OF THE SCIENCE OF ENERGY AND FUELS IN ALL APPLICATIONS AND USES.
Governing document: ROYAL CHARTER AND BYE-LAWS AS APPROVED BY ORDER IN COUNCIL ON 08 MAY 2003
